Chas Freeman, President of the Middle East Policy Council and former Ambassador to Saudi Arabia, delivers the final opening statement against the resolution. Amb. Freeman says Iraq is militarily occupied by the U.S. and politically occupied by Iran. He cites a series of polls indicating Iraqi citizens' dislike of U.S. troops in their country. He agrees that it's important to defeat Al Qaida in Iraq and to prevent Iranian influence, but he argues the most effective way to achieve this is to redeploy U.S. troops outside Iraq.
